Quiz Answer Key and Fun Facts
1. What type of animal did Matilda Jane Roberts catch and throw at the Ranger troop in the first chapter of the book?

Answer: Turtle

She caught a snapping turtle in a river and walked toward the Rangers with it. When she got closer, she "swung her arm a time or two and heaved the big turtle in the general direction of a bunch of Rangers...They scattered like quails when they saw the turtle sailing through the air."
2. There were many Rangers in the book, "Dead Man's Walk." Which of them was the oldest?

Answer: Shadrach

"The oldest Ranger, a tall, grizzled specimen with a cloudy past...".
3. Buffalo Hump had Comanche names for some of the Rangers. Which Ranger had the Comanche name, "Tail-Of-The-Bear?

Answer: Shadrach

Buffalo Hump once ate with the Rangers and wanted Matty, whom he called Turtle-Catching-Woman, to become his wife. Colonel Cobb asked his scout what Shadrach was called in Comanche and was told that it was Tail-Of-The-Bear. Cobb then told Buffalo Hump that Matty was the wife of Tail-Of-The-Bear. Buffalo Hump said that if Shadrach ever crossed the Canadian River he would take his scalp, the woman and his horse.
4. Which man did Buffalo Hump call Gun-In-The-Water?

Answer: Woodrow Call

Augustus was called "Silver Hair McCrae" because of his hair turning white at such an early age. Buffalo Hump, to the best of my knowledge, had no names for Bigfoot or Long Bill. Call got his name by shooting and killing one of Buffalo Humps' sons while in a flooded river. Buffalo Humps' son was trying to kill the Rangers by floating between the legs of a dead mule.
5. Before Woodrow Call was promoted to a corporal, someone started calling him Corporal Call. Who had the insight to name him a corporal before the promotion?

Answer: Clara Forsythe

Clara had starting calling him Corporal Call before he received his promotion. This fact did not go over very well with Augustus, who already had his sights set on Clara.
6. Although Buffalo Hump was recognized as the killer of his tribe, he was not the best thief. Which of Buffalo Humps' warriors did the Rangers consider to be the best horse thief of the Indian tribe?

Answer: Kicking Wolf

Kicking Wolf was said to be able to steal a horse with a man still sitting on it.
7. Once they were inside the leper colony, a ceremony was held. Each man had to be blindfolded and reach inside a jar full of black and white beans. A white bean meant you would live and a black bean meant you would be executed. Who was the first person to draw out a black bean?

Answer: Bigfoot Wallace

Woodrow Call was blindfolded and drew out the first bean which was white. Bigfoot Wallace drew second and pulled out the first of the black beans.
8. Buffalo Hump was the Comanche Indian in the story of "Dead Man's Walk". What was the name of the Apache Indian from the story?

Answer: Gomez

Bigfoot Wallace once had a dream that Buffalo Hump and the Apache Gomez were raiding together.
9. In the last chapter of the book, Lady Carey funded a trip back to San Antonio with the surviving Rangers. How many Rangers were alive to start the trip back with her?

Answer: Five

Augustus McCrae, Woodrow Call, Long Bill Coleman, Wesley Buttons and Quartermaster Brognoli were the only men returning. Matty (Matilda) also survived and made the return trip back to San Antonio.
10. How many lashes, with a whip, was Woodrow Call ordered to receive for attacking Colonel Caleb Cobb?

Answer: 100

Colonel Cobb surrendered all of the Rangers, including himself, to the Mexican army. After surrendering, he decided to leave with General Dimasio, of the Mexican army, to go to Santa Fe. Call was not very appreciative of the fact that they were to be given up to the Mexican army while the Colonel was taking a trip to Santa Fe.

He attacked the buggy that Cobb was sitting in and as punishment for this, was ordered to receive 100 lashes with a whip. He was told by Captain Salazar that, "Fifty lashes is usually enough to kill a man, Corporal."
